| | | | | | | | | | | | | | | | | | | | | | | | | | | | | LOCK_THREAD_COUNT When using the performance schema file io instrumentation in MySQL 5.5, a thread would loop forever inside lf_pinbox_put_pins, when disconnecting. It would also hold LOCK_thread_count while doing so, effectively killing the server. The root cause of the loop in lf_pinbox_put_pins() is a leak of LF_PINS, when used with the filename_hash LF_HASH table in the performance schema. This fix contains the following changes: 1) Added the missing call to lf_hash_search_unpin(), to prevent the leak. 2) In mysys/lf_alloc-pin.c, there was some extra debugging code (MY_LF_EXTRA_DEBUG) written to detect precisely this kind of issues, but it was never used. Replaced MY_LF_EXTRA_DEBUG with DBUG_OFF, so that leaks similar to this one can be always detected in regular debug builds. 3) Backported the fix for the following bug, from 5.6 to 5.5: Bug#13417446 - 63339: INCORRECT FILE PATH IN PEFORMANCE_SCHEMA ON WINDOWS

|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| GCC 4.6 has new -Wunused-but-set-variable flag, which is enabled by -Wall, that causes GCC to emit a warning whenever a local variable is assigned to, but otherwise unused (aside from its declaration). Since the maintainer mode uses -Wall and -Werror, source code which triggers these warnings will be rejected. That is, these warnings become hard errors. The solution is to fix the code which triggers these specific warnings. The implementation of a storage engine (subclasses of handler) is not supposed to call my_error() directly inside the engine implementation, but only return error codes, and report errors later at the demand of the sql layer only (if needed), using handler::print_error(). This fix removes misplaced calls to my_error(), and provide an implementation of print_error() instead. Given that the sql layer implementation of create table, ha_create_table(), does not use print_error() but returns ER_CANT_CREATE_TABLE directly, the return code for create table statements using the performance schema has changed to ER_CANT_CREATE_TABLE. |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Bug#54678: InnoDB, TRUNCATE, ALTER, I_S SELECT, crash or deadlock - Incompatible change: truncate no longer resorts to a row by row delete if the storage engine does not support the truncate method. Consequently, the count of affected rows does not, in any case, reflect the actual number of rows. - Incompatible change: it is no longer possible to truncate a table that participates as a parent in a foreign key constraint, unless it is a self-referencing constraint (both parent and child are in the same table). To work around this incompatible change and still be able to truncate such tables, disable foreign checks with SET foreign_key_checks=0 before truncate. Alternatively, if foreign key checks are necessary, please use a DELETE statement without a WHERE condition. Problem description: The problem was that for storage engines that do not support truncate table via a external drop and recreate, such as InnoDB which implements truncate via a internal drop and recreate, the delete_all_rows method could be invoked with a shared metadata lock, causing problems if the engine needed exclusive access to some internal metadata. This problem originated with the fact that there is no truncate specific handler method, which ended up leading to a abuse of the delete_all_rows method that is primarily used for delete operations without a condition. Solution: The solution is to introduce a truncate handler method that is invoked when the engine does not support truncation via a table drop and recreate. This method is invoked under a exclusive metadata lock, so that there is only a single instance of the table when the method is invoked. Also, the method is not invoked and a error is thrown if the table is a parent in a non-self-referencing foreign key relationship. This was necessary to avoid inconsistency as some integrity checks are bypassed. | | | | | | | | | | | | | | | | CHECKSUM TABLE for performance schema tables could cause uninitialized memory reads. The root cause is a design flaw in the implementation of mysql_checksum_table(), which do not honor null fields. However, fixing this bug in CHECKSUM TABLE is risky, as it can cause the checksum value to change. This fix implements a work around, to systematically reset fields values even for null fields, so that the field memory representation is always initialized with a known value.

| | | | | | | | | | | | | | | | EXTENDED Before this fix, the server could crash inside a memcpy when reading data from the EVENTS_WAITS_CURRENT / HISTORY / HISTORY_LONG tables. The root cause is that the length used in a memcpy could be corrupted, when another thread writes data in the wait record being read. Reading unsafe data is ok, per design choice, and the code does sanitize the data in general, but did not sanitize the length given to memcpy. The fix is to also sanitize the schema name / object name / file name length when extracting the data to produce a row.

|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Essentially, the problem is that safemalloc is excruciatingly slow as it checks all allocated blocks for overrun at each memory management primitive, yielding a almost exponential slowdown for the memory management functions (malloc, realloc, free). The overrun check basically consists of verifying some bytes of a block for certain magic keys, which catches some simple forms of overrun. Another minor problem is violation of aliasing rules and that its own internal list of blocks is prone to corruption. Another issue with safemalloc is rather the maintenance cost as the tool has a significant impact on the server code. Given the magnitude of memory debuggers available nowadays, especially those that are provided with the platform malloc implementation, maintenance of a in-house and largely obsolete memory debugger becomes a burden that is not worth the effort due to its slowness and lack of support for detecting more common forms of heap corruption. Since there are third-party tools that can provide the same functionality at a lower or comparable performance cost, the solution is to simply remove safemalloc. Third-party tools can provide the same functionality at a lower or comparable performance cost. The removal of safemalloc also allows a simplification of the malloc wrappers, removing quite a bit of kludge: redefinition of my_malloc, my_free and the removal of the unused second argument of my_free. Since free() always check whether the supplied pointer is null, redudant checks are also removed. |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The unit test pfs_instr-t: - generates a very long (10,000) bytes file name - calls find_or_create_file. This leads to a buffer overflow in mysys in my_realpath(), because my_realpath and mysys file APIs in general do not test for input parameters: mysys assumes every file name is less that FN_REFLEN in length. Calling find_or_create_file with a very long file name is likely to happen when instrumenting third party code that does not use mysys, so this test is legitimate. The fix is to make find_or_create_file in the performance schema more robust in this case.

| | | | | | | | | | | | | | | | | | | | | | | | | This patch prevents system threads and system table accesses from using user-specified values for "lock_wait_timeout". Instead all such accesses are done using the default value (1 year). This prevents background tasks (such as replication, events, accessing stored function definitions, logging, reading time-zone information, etc.) from failing in cases where the global value of "lock_wait_timeout" is set very low. The patch also simplifies the open tables API. Rather than adding another convenience function for opening and locking system tables, this patch removes most of the existing convenience functions for open_and_lock_tables_derived(). Before, open_and_lock_tables() was a convenience function that enforced derived tables handling, while open_and_lock_tables_derived() was the main function where derived tables handling was optional. Now, this convencience function is gone and the main function is renamed to open_and_lock_tables().
